The Search for a Car Air Freshener That Actually Works
I was tired of replacing car air fresheners every two weeks. The cardboard trees lose their scent fast, the gel ones melt in summer heat, and the sprays smell artificial. When I spotted this wooden box design for $2.96, I figured it was worth testing despite my skepticism.
What You Actually Get
This isn't your typical hanging air freshener. It's a small wooden box that sits in your cup holder or dashboard. The wood absorbs and slowly releases fragrance over time, creating a subtle but consistent scent in your car.
The construction surprised me for the price point. The wood has a smooth finish and feels solid, not like cheap particle board. It's compact enough to fit anywhere without looking out of place. I went with the jasmine scent based on customer reviews mentioning it specifically.
The concept is simple: the porous wood holds fragrance oil and releases it gradually. No batteries, no refills needed initially, just place and forget.
What Impressed Me and What Didn't
The good stuff: Three months in, it's still working. The scent is much more subtle than chemical air fresheners, which I actually prefer. It never becomes overwhelming, even on hot days when other air fresheners can be suffocating. No sticky residue, no mess.
The honest limitation: The scent strength is genuinely light. If you want something that will make your entire car smell strongly of jasmine, this won't do it. It's more like a gentle background fragrance.
What $2.96 Usually Gets You

At this price point, you're typically looking at cardboard tree air fresheners that last a week, or cheap spray bottles that smell obviously synthetic. This wooden option delivers a more premium experience and significantly better longevity.
A comparable wooden air freshener from a major brand would run $8-15, but I'm not seeing enough difference to justify the markup.
My Bottom Line
Buy it if: You prefer subtle, natural-feeling scents over strong artificial ones, you want something that lasts months not weeks, or you're looking for a budget option that doesn't look cheap.
Skip it if: You need a powerful fragrance to mask odors, you change cars frequently, or you prefer being able to control scent intensity.
My score: 8/10 - Excellent value for anyone who values longevity and subtlety over intensity.
